
Potagannissing Bay and its complex archipelago of islands define this mid-century maritime survey along the international border between Michigan and Ontario. The landscape is characterized by the varied terrain of Drummond Twp, where large tracts of the Lake Superior State Forest cover the southern shorelines. To the east, the Harbor Island National Wildlife Refuge encompasses several landmasses including the horseshoe-shaped Harbor Island, while the western waters are marked by the navigational passage of the De Tour Passage Saint Marys River.
